MOTORCOACH WASHINGTON / OREGON / NORTHERN CALIFORNIA
June 14 – June 30, 2012 (17 days)
Escorted by Wayne Barnes
Approximately $2,799 from Baton Rouge
FOCUS on the beautiful northwestern part of our country. Journey through 15 states plus Victoria, Canada. Includes Arches National Park, Salt Lake City, Redwood Forest, Gold Beach, Seattle, Butchart Gardens, Montana, Yellowstone.

Day 1, Thur., June 14 – Wichita Falls, Texas – Early morning departure from Zachary and Baton Rouge. Routing is
along I-10 to Lafayette, I-49 through Alexandria to Shreveport, I-20 to Dallas. Overnight in Wichita Falls.
Day 2, Fri., June 15 – Albuquerque, New Mexico – Through Amarillo, Texas to Albuquerque, New Mexico for
overnight. Visit “Old Town”.
Day 3, Sat., June 16 – Moab, Utah – Visit 4-Corners, where you can stand in 4 states at one time. Through northeast
Arizona to Moab, Utah for overnight.
Day 4, Sun., June 17 – Salt Lake City, Utah – Morning visit to Dead Horse Point State Park for spectacular view.
Then tour Arches National Park. Overnight in Salt Lake City.
Day 5, Mon., June 18 – Winnemucca, Nevada – Morning tour of Salt Lake City. Overnight Winnemucca.
Day 6, Tues., June 19 – Redding, California – Into the mountains of northern California. Visit Lassen National Park.
Overnight Redding.
Day 7, Wed., June 20 – Gold Beach, Oregon – Through the Trinity Mountains to the Pacific coast and Eureka,
CA. Along the coast and through Redwood National Park. Two nights in Gold Beach on the Oregon coast.
Day 8, Thur., June 21 – Gold Beach – A day to enjoy this beautiful coast and wild Rogue River.
Day 9, Fri., June 22 – Portland, Oregon – Drive along the spectacular Oregon coast, considered by many to be the most
beautiful in the U.S.A.
Day 10, Sat., June 23 – Port Angeles, Washington – Visit Columbia River, Mt. St. Helens and Olympic Peninsula.
Day 11, Sun., June 24 - Seattle, Washington – Morning ferry to Victoria, Canada. Visit wonderful Butchart
Gardens, perhaps the world’s most famous. Ferry across the Puget Sound through beautiful San Juan Islands to
Anacortes, WA. Overnight in Seattle area.
Day 12, Mon., June 25 – Seattle – Guided tour includes the Space Needle, Pioneer Square and Pike’s Place Market.
Day 13, Tues., June 26 – Missoula Montana – Through the Cascade Mountains to Spokane. Then through Coeur
d’Alene, Idaho and into the mountains of Montana. Overnight in Missoula, Montana.
Day 14, Wed., June 27 – Jackson, Wyoming – Through Montana to Yellowstone. See Old Faithful and Grand
Tetons. Overnight Jackson.
Day 15, Thur., June 28 – Denver, Colorado - Through Wyoming to Denver.
Day 16, Fri., June 29 – Oklahoma City – Through Kansas and Oklahoma. Visit Memorial.
Day 17, Sat., June 30- Drive home via Dallas and Shreveport. Arrive Baton Rouge about 7:30 p.m.
